After alleged Syria strike, PM says Israel acting against ‘enemy in vicinity’


(Worthy News) –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u on Wednesday said Israel was carrying out pre-emptive attacks to prevent its “enemy” from establishing military bases “in our vicinity,” in an apparent acknowledgment of a strike earlier in the day on alleged Hezbollah facilities across the border in Syria.

“We respond with attacks and force to every attack against us. But we are not only taking action after the fact, we are also denying the enemy capabilities before the fact. In a systematic and consistent way, we are working to prevent our enemy from establishing attack bases against us and in our vicinity,” Netanyahu said.

In the predawn hours of Wednesday morning, Syrian state media reported that Israel fired several missiles toward a mountain near the Golan border. [ Source: Times of Israel (Read More…) ]
